Kevin John Musick 1952 - 1977

Kevin John Musick was born on November 15, 1952, and died at age 24 years old on May 25, 1977. Kevin Musick was buried at Rock Island National Cemetery Section N Site 917 Bldg 118 - Rock Island Arsenal, in Rock Island, Il. In 1952, in the year that Kevin John Musick was born, on February 6th, George VI of England died from a coronary thrombosis and complications due to lung cancer. His eldest daughter, age 25, immediately ascended the throne as Elizabeth II and her coronation was on June 2 1953.

In 1960, he was merely 8 years old when on May 1st, an American CIA U-2 spy plane, piloted by Francis Gary Powers, was shot down by a surface-to-air missile over the Soviet Union. Powers ejected and survived but was captured. The U.S. claimed that the U-2 was a "weather plane" but Powers was convicted in the Soviet Union of espionage. He was released in 1962 after 1 year, 9 months and 10 days in prison.
